WebMe and my son Chuckie! WebMini Bio (1) Singer Chuck Negron was born on June 8, 1942 in New York City. He grew up in the Bronx. His parents were Charles and Elizabeth Negron. At age fifteen, Negron had already recorded his first single and performed at the legendary Apollo Theater with his doo-wop group The Rondells. Moreover, Chuck played basketball in both schoolyard ... In 2006, Negron was featured in an episode of the A&E reality show Intervention about his son, Chuckie, and grandson, Noah. Negron has been married four times. He was married to Paula Louise Ann Goetten from 1970–73 and they had a daughter, Shaunti Negron-Levick. He is best known as one of the three lead vocalists in the rock band Three Dog Night, which he helped form in 1968. See more In 1967, singer Danny Hutton invited Negron to join him and Cory Wells to found the band Three Dog Night.
